Dandrabeda is a village located in Chitrakonda Taluk of Malkangiri district in Odisha. Around 83 families reside in Dandrabeda village. Dandrabeda village is administered by Sarpanch(Head of village) who is elected every five years.
As per the Census India 2011, Dandrabeda village has population of 400 of which 182 are males and 218 are females. The population of children between age 0-6 is 111 which is 27.75% of total population.
The sex-ratio of Dandrabeda village is around
1198 compared to
979 which is average of Odisha state. The literacy rate of Dandrabeda village is 12% out of which 16.48% males are literate and 8.26% females are literate. There are 0 Scheduled Caste (SC) and 100% Scheduled Tribe (ST) of total population in Dandrabeda village.
